库存管理系统面向对象分析与设计
时间: 2023-11-23 09:07:50 浏览: 218
库存管理系统是一个广泛应用于各种企业和商业场景中的重要系统。面向对象分析与设计是一种软件开发方法,它强调将系统中的实体和行为建模为对象,以便更好地理解和管理系统。在库存管理系统中,可以通过面向对象分析与设计来设计出高效、可靠、易于维护的系统。
在面向对象分析与设计中,首先需要确定系统中的各个实体。对于库存管理系统而言,实体可以包括库存、商品、订单、用户等。然后,需要确定这些实体之间的关系和行为。例如,库存与商品之间是一对多的关系,用户可以创建订单等。
在确定实体和关系之后,就可以进行系统设计。设计时需要考虑到系统的可扩展性、可维护性、可测试性等方面。可以使用UML等工具进行建模,确定类、方法、属性等。
在实现过程中,需要采用合适的设计模式和编程语言来实现系统。例如,可以使用工厂模式来创建订单对象,使用Java等面向对象语言来实现系统。
总之,通过面向对象分析与设计,可以设计出高效、可靠、易于维护的库存管理系统。
阅读全文